摘要:跨域产生同源策略限制同源是指域名,协议,端口相同。跨域资源共享需要被请求方的服务端设置。服务器代理客户端访问服务器,并在服务器上做代理访问服务器把请求结果返回客户端,即实现了客户端请求服务器的跨域需求。
跨域产生
1.跨域资源共享(CORS)同源策略限制,同源是指:域名,协议,端口相同。
需要被请求方的服务端设置: Access-Control-Allow-Origin。兼容性不够好,在IE10以下的浏览器不支持。
2.服务器代理A客户端访问A服务器,并在A服务器上做代理访问B服务器把请求结果返回A客户端,即实现了A客户端请求B服务器的跨域需求。
3.JSONP原理:所有具有src属性的HTML标签都是可以跨域的,包括